SecureStack C2 Usage Considerations
In
normal
usage
(and
typical
implementations)
there
is
no
need
to
modify
any
of
the
default
LACP
parameters
on
the
switch.
The
default
values
will
result
in
the
maximum
number
of
aggregations
possible.
If
the
switch
is
placed
in
a
configuration
with
its
peers
not
running
the
protocol,
no
dynamic
link
aggregations
will
be
formed
and
the
switch
will
function
normally
(that
is,
will
block
redundant
paths).
For
information
about
building
static
aggregations,
refer
to
set
lacp
static
Each
SecureStack
C2
module
provides
six
virtual
link
aggregator
ports,
which
are
designated
in
the
CLI
as
lag.0.1
through
lag.0.6
.
Each
LAG
can
have
up
toeight
associated
physical
ports.
Once
underlying
physical
ports
(for
example,
ge
.x.x
,
or
ge
.x.x
)
are
associated
with
an
aggregator
port,
the
resulting
aggregation
will
be
represented
as
one
LAG
with
a
lag.x.x
port
designation.
LACP
determines
which
underlying
physical
ports
are
capable
of
aggregating
by
comparing
operational
keys.
Aggregator
ports
allow
only
underlying
ports
with
keys
matching
theirs
to
join
their
LAG.
LACP
uses
a
system
priority
value
to
build
a
LAG
ID,
which
determines
aggregation
precedence.
If
there
are
two
partner
devices
competing
for
the
same
aggregator,
LACP
compares
the
LAG
IDs
for
each
grouping
of
ports.
The
LAG
with
the
lower
LAG
ID
is
given
precedence
and
will
be
allowed
to
use
the
aggregator.
There
are
a
few
cases
in
which
ports
will
not
aggregate:
•
An
underlying
physical
port
is
attached
to
another
port
on
this
same
switch
(loopback).
LAG
Link Aggregation Group. Once underlying physical ports (for example,
ge
.x.x
)
are associated with an aggregator port, the resulting aggregation will be
represented as one LAG with a
lag.x.x
port designation.
SecureStack C2 LAGs can have up to 8associated physical ports.
LACPDU
Link Aggregation Control Protocol Data Unit. The protocol exchanges
aggregation state/mode information by way of a port’s actor and partner
operational states. LACPDUs sent by the first party (the actor) convey to the
second party (the actor’s protocol partner) what the actor knows, both about
its own state and that of its partner.
Actor and Partner
An actor is the local device sending LACPDUs. Its protocol partner is the
device on the other end of the link aggregation. Each maintains current status
of the other via LACPDUs containing information about their ports’ LACP
status and operational state.
Admin Key
Value assigned to aggregator ports and physical ports that are candidates for
joining a LAG. The LACP implementation on SecureStack C2 devices will use
this value to form an oper key and will determine which underlying physical
ports are capable of aggregating by comparing oper keys. Aggregator ports
allow only underlying ports with oper keys matching theirs to join their LAG.
On SecureStack C2 devices, the default admin key value is 32768.
System Priority
Value used to build a LAG ID, which determines aggregation precedence. If
there are two partner devices competing for the same aggregator, LACP
compares the LAG IDs for each grouping of ports. The LAG with the lower
LAG ID is given precedence and will be allowed to use the aggregator.
Note:
Only one LACP system priority can be set on a
SecureStack C2 device, using either the
set lacp asyspri
command (
), or the
set port lacp
command
